Transaction 4282cf90ebd22be9b39805f8c3b9fef91b34da8926b4497fe0ea563ecd5dfa41

1 Input
2 Outputs
  • 4282cf90ebd22be9b39805f8c3b9fef91b34da8926b4497fe0ea563ecd5dfa41:0
  • value  618871
    address  3JDf8nuu4LHtCTQYmMnV4mrXad3oLEq6h8
  • 4282cf90ebd22be9b39805f8c3b9fef91b34da8926b4497fe0ea563ecd5dfa41:1
  • value  1021314542
    address  34ycnb4BhxUqLtnnQrbvYSNJeBU9bNu3yt